Performance Update


As some of you may know, I spent all of 2016 and most of 2017 being a sort of hermit, making my own technological breakthroughs and discoveries in the art of game programming. Most of these breakthroughs have accumulated into The Temple of Max.

Anyways, my first games that used a form of graphics beyond ascii had horrible flickering issues and was overall just choppy and primitive. I was bored today, and these issues have been bothering me for the past year. All it took was a few simple lines of code, and the results are astounding when compared to the original launch version. In my opinion, this new version is the definitive version of Lasers of Mars. I’ve also given this treatment to Quadrilateral Drive, in case anyone was wondering.

That’s about all I have to say. Thanks for reading, and enjoy the fixes!
